Taxus baccata, also known as yew, is an evergreen tree found in Europe, North Africa, and parts of Asia. This long-lived plant can grow up to 20 meters tall and is characterized by its needle-like leaves and red berries.
The yew has a long history in traditional medicine. In ancient times, it was often associated with protection and longevity. The various parts of the plant, particularly the bark and needles, are rich in alkaloids, making it an interesting subject of study in pharmacology.
